Possible explosion reported near Windsor AveChicago IL

W Windsor Ave, Chicago, IL 60630

As discussed during the dispatch call, police responded to a possible explosion near Windsor Avenue in Chicago. A caller reported hearing a loud noise and seeing two individuals leaving the area in a small silver SUV. Officers checked the area but found no power outages or further problems. The cause of the noise remains undetermined.
